Understanding Net Worth in the Media World
When people ask about someone's net worth, they are, in a way, asking about their overall financial picture. This figure includes everything someone owns, like savings, investments, property, and other valuable items, minus any debts they might have. How do news anchors and reporters typically earn their income?
News anchors and reporters generally earn their income through a fixed salary paid by the television station, radio station, or news organization they work for. This salary can be influenced by their experience, the size of the market they are in, and their specific role. Some might also receive bonuses or benefits as part of their compensation package, you know.
What factors can cause a media personality's net worth to change over time?
A media personality's net worth can change due to several factors. Salary increases from new contracts, successful investments, or earnings from side ventures like endorsements or public speaking can boost it. On the other hand, significant expenses, market downturns affecting investments, or career changes could also impact their financial standing. It's a pretty dynamic situation, really.
Are salaries for media professionals higher in larger cities?
Typically, salaries for media professionals tend to be higher in larger media markets, such as major metropolitan areas, compared to smaller cities. This is because larger markets often have more viewers or listeners, which translates into more advertising revenue for the media outlets. However, the higher cost of living in these larger cities can sometimes offset the higher pay, so it's, you know, a bit of a trade-off.
